public static final class ExplanationMetadataOverride.Builder extends GeneratedMessageV3.Builder<ExplanationMetadataOverride.Builder> implements ExplanationMetadataOverrideOrBuilder
The ExplanationMetadata entries that can be overridden at
online explanation time.
Protobuf type google.cloud.aiplatform.v1.ExplanationMetadataOverride
Methods
public ExplanationMetadataOverride.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
Returns
Overrides
public ExplanationMetadataOverride build()
Returns
public ExplanationMetadataOverride buildPartial()
Returns
public ExplanationMetadataOverride.Builder clear()
Returns
Overrides
public ExplanationMetadataOverride.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
Returns
Overrides
public ExplanationMetadataOverride.Builder clearInputs()
Returns
public ExplanationMetadataOverride.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
Returns
Overrides
public ExplanationMetadataOverride.Builder clone()
Returns
Overrides
public boolean containsInputs(String key)
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Parameter
Returns
public ExplanationMetadataOverride getDefaultInstanceForType()
Returns
public static final Descriptors.Descriptor getDescriptor()
Returns
public Descriptors.Descriptor getDescriptorForType()
Returns
Overrides
public Map<String,ExplanationMetadataOverride.InputMetadataOverride> getInputs()
Returns
public int getInputsCount()
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Returns
public Map<String,ExplanationMetadataOverride.InputMetadataOverride> getInputsMap()
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Returns
public ExplanationMetadataOverride.InputMetadataOverride getInputsOrDefault(String key, ExplanationMetadataOverride.InputMetadataOverride defaultValue)
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Parameters
Returns
public ExplanationMetadataOverride.InputMetadataOverride getInputsOrThrow(String key)
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Parameter
Returns
public Map<String,ExplanationMetadataOverride.InputMetadataOverride> getMutableInputs()
Use alternate mutation accessors instead.
Returns
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Overrides
protected MapField internalGetMapField(int number)
Parameter
Returns
Overrides
protected MapField internalGetMutableMapField(int number)
Parameter
Returns
Overrides
public final boolean isInitialized()
Returns
Overrides
public ExplanationMetadataOverride.Builder mergeFrom(ExplanationMetadataOverride other)
Parameter
Returns
public ExplanationMetadataOverride.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Overrides
Exceptions
public ExplanationMetadataOverride.Builder mergeFrom(Message other)
Parameter
Returns
Overrides
public final ExplanationMetadataOverride.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
Returns
Overrides
public ExplanationMetadataOverride.Builder putAllInputs(Map<String,ExplanationMetadataOverride.InputMetadataOverride> values)
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Parameter
Returns
public ExplanationMetadataOverride.Builder putInputs(String key, ExplanationMetadataOverride.InputMetadataOverride value)
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Parameters
Returns
public ExplanationMetadataOverride.Builder removeInputs(String key)
Required. Overrides the input metadata of the features.
The key is the name of the feature to be overridden. The keys specified
here must exist in the input metadata to be overridden. If a feature is
not specified here, the corresponding feature's input metadata is not
overridden.
map<string, .google.cloud.aiplatform.v1.ExplanationMetadataOverride.InputMetadataOverride> inputs = 1 [(.google.api.field_behavior) = REQUIRED];
Parameter
Returns
public ExplanationMetadataOverride.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
Returns
Overrides
public ExplanationMetadataOverride.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
Returns
Overrides
public final ExplanationMetadataOverride.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
Returns
Overrides